Job Description

Bridge Property Management is seeking a creative and detail-oriented Talent Management Associate with a passion for building engaging learning content. This role is perfect for someone who thrives on creating impactful training materials—think videos, eLearning modules, guides, and toolkits—that empower employees at every level. While you’ll support all aspects of learning and development, your primary focus will be content creation that drives performance and fosters professional growth across our multi-family property teams.

We’re looking for someone who knows how to turn complex topics into accessible, enjoyable training experiences—whether it's for new hire onboarding, leadership development, or operational skills. If you have a strong background in instructional design, multimedia learning tools, and enjoy being the creative force behind effective training, we want to hear from you.

What You’ll Do

  • Design and develop engaging learning content including online courses, instructional videos, digital guides, and job aids tailored to our property management operations.
  • Facilitate live training sessions (in-person and virtual) on company standards, systems, and customer experience best practices.
  • Build and maintain a training content library and ensure materials are updated, accessible, and aligned with business needs.
  • Partner with subject matter experts to translate operational knowledge into effective learning experiences.
  • Manage and optimize our LMS platform and other eLearning tools to ensure seamless delivery and tracking of content.
  • Monitor training effectiveness using assessments, surveys, and performance data—and adjust content accordingly.
  • Assist in the development of robust onboarding programs to set new hires up for success.
  • Support employee engagement efforts by running surveys, analyzing feedback, and providing actionable insights.
  • Stay current with trends in instructional design, adult learning theory, and digital training tools to continuously elevate our programs.

What We’re Looking For

  • Proven experience in instructional design or learning content development, preferably in a corporate setting with multiple entities.
  • Bonus points for experience in property management or multifamily housing!
  • Skilled in eLearning authoring tools (Articulate, Adobe Captivate, etc.), LMS platforms, and video editing software.
  • Strong facilitation and presentation skills; able to lead engaging training sessions.
  • Tech-savvy and creative—comfortable experimenting with new tools and formats.
  • Exceptionally organized, with the ability to manage multiple projects and meet deadlines.
  • Able to work independ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ment.
  • High level of discretion when handling confidential or sensitive information.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ills with a focus on clarity, tone, and learner engagement.
